Welcome to MatchHound! Heads up: the pairing service occasionally stalls for 2-3 seconds during GC pauses, usually when the candidate pool spikes after a batch import. We tune heap settings per region, so don't copy configs blindly. Full tuning notes and the pause-budget dashboard are documented on the internal page below.

dashboard of fajop-kajeg = https://artifactory.paliqnet.example/settings

**Ticket: Config drift on BounceSift processor**

The email bounce processor in the Larkfield environment has drifted from the values committed in the release branch. Retry windows and suppression thresholds no longer match, which likely explains the duplicate suppression entries reported Tuesday. Please reconcile before the Thursday cut. For reference, the currently deployed configuration on the live node reads as follows.

config for yajep-yahof:
[briax]
port = 9200
region = outer-2
host = briax.nelvrocorp.test
team = raleth
timeout_ms = 1500
retries = 1

// RECON_BATCH_SIZE controls how many warehouse rows the Stockweave
// reconciliation job pulls per cycle. The nightly run compares Bin-level
// counts from the Farrowgate depot feed against ledger totals in Tallyvane.
// If the job stalls, check the drift table first — partial batches leave
// tombstone rows that block the next run. Do not bump this above 500
// without clearing the tombstones; the Tallyvane writer will deadlock.
// When paging the pipeline team, quote the token from the line below.

pipeline stamp: htk31_f769b577b3028a4e9958e5bb8d1259a

Account recovery — Hollowpine Wiki (RBAC notes for review)

When an administrator account on the Hollowpine wiki is recovered, role bindings are restored from the last signed snapshot, not from live state. This prevents a compromised session from persisting elevated roles through recovery. The reviewer should confirm that the restored account holds only the Editor and Space-Admin roles, with no residual global grants. Completing the restore requires unsealing the snapshot, which prompts for the recovery passphrase below.

unlock words, tawif-tahop: oliys-ulawyn-tamdor-lamys-casox-jormir-fraius-kasath-ulador-ulamir-holir-sorys-holeth